Output 51f025cddb2a2742f183e0ea17651ec9c010a219e05f37ec902113b5fb80856c:20

value
11506286
script pubkey
OP_0 OP_PUSHBYTES_20 4f44c83debe96296376e3b5efd4de1348e5f895c
address
ltc1qfazvs00ta93fvdmw8d006n0pxj89lz2uc77y2u
transaction
51f025cddb2a2742f183e0ea17651ec9c010a219e05f37ec902113b5fb80856c
spent
true